Title :
Performance of a micro-macrocellular system with overlapping coverage and channel rearrangement techniques

Abstract :
In this paper, a new way to manage users having different mobility in a two-tier cellular system, through the use of the techniques of overlapping coverage and channel rearrangement, is provided. Overlapping coverage areas of nearby base stations arise in cellular communications systems, especially in small cell high-capacity microcellular configurations. With overlap, some users may have access to channels at more that one base station. This enhanced access can be used to improve teletraffic performance characteristics. Channel rearrangements are used to benefit users who are in range of only one base station. An analytical model is developed to determine performance measures
